Output 3df21424b8b0d56f594a21233ee4d31474442e78c7d555fd85fb2944062e3b58:3

value
32940212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41b6bd54a958f49389603b69706a4a15b15565e6 OP_EQUAL
address
MDtd4sFqV2b752HTMUNVr1QBUKwJsZxeet
transaction
3df21424b8b0d56f594a21233ee4d31474442e78c7d555fd85fb2944062e3b58
spent
true